|  | 1. | Once I though I walked with Jesus, | 
|  |  | Yet such changeful feelings had; | 
|  |  | Sometimes trusting, sometimes doubting, | 
|  |  | Sometimes joyful, sometimes sad. | 
|  |  | Oh, the peace the Savior gives! | 
|  |  | Peace I never knew before; | 
|  |  | And my way has brighter grown | 
|  |  | Since I've learned to trust Him more. | 
|  | 2. | But He call'd me closer to Him, | 
|  |  | Bade my doubting, fearing, cease; | 
|  |  | And when I had fully yielded, | 
|  |  | Filled my soul with perfect peace. | 
|  | 3. | Now I'm trusting every moment, | 
|  |  | Nothing less can be enough; | 
|  |  | And the Savior bears me gently | 
|  |  | O'er those places once so rough. | 
|  | 4. | Day by day my soul He's keeping | 
|  |  | By His wondrous power within; | 
|  |  | And my heart is full of singing | 
|  |  | To my Savior from all sin. |
